FAQ

Conductivity ranking?

Silver > copper > gold > aluminum > steel > stainless > plastic.

Why aluminum vs copper?

Aluminum lighter, cheaper. Copper more conductive. Trade-off per application.

Conductive plastics?

Carbon-loaded conductive plastics 10⁵-10⁹ Ω/sq. Anti-static (10⁹-10¹²) common.

Surface vs volume?

Surface for static dissipation. Volume for through-thickness conductivity.

Testing methods?

ASTM D257 surface and volume resistivity. Eddy current for conductors.

Application examples?

Copper wiring, aluminum bus bars, ESD-safe trays, conductive paint for shielding.
